The PP was very common in .32. I ordered a West German Police trade-in back in the 80s. It still had it’s box and was beautifully made.
They were actually available in .25, .32, .380 and .22LR. The .380 was popular in the U.S.
The PPK was available in the same calibers.
The PPK/s was I think only sold in the U.S. I am not sure about the calibers but every one I have seen was in .380.
